C/C++ Runner🚀 OverviewC/C++ Runner adalah extension Visual Studio Code sederhana yang dirancang untuk mempercepat alur kerja Anda dengan memungkinkan kompilasi dan eksekusi file C dan C++ secara cepat menggunakan GCC/G++ di jendela konsol terpisah. Extension ini unik karena memberikan Anda kontrol penuh atas shell eksekusi (PowerShell atau CMD) dan secara otomatis menahan jendela konsol agar Anda dapat melihat output program tanpa perlu menambahkan command system("pause") secara manual. Fitur Utama
🛠️ PersyaratanUntuk menggunakan extension ini, Anda harus memiliki kompiler GCC (GNU Compiler Collection) yang terinstal pada sistem Anda.
Penggunaan & Command
|
Command ID | Title (Judul) | Function (Fungsi/Keterangan) |
---|---|---|
cpp-runner.run (F5) |
Jalankan File C/C++ | Mengkompilasi dan mengeksekusi program. |
cpp-runner.restart |
Restart Jalankan C/C++ | Menghentikan proses yang sedang berjalan dan memulai ulang eksekusi. |
cpp-runner.stop |
Hentikan Jalankan C/C++ | Menghentikan paksa (terminate) proses eksekusi konsol. |
cpp-runner.openSettings |
Buka Pengaturan C/C++ Runner | Menavigasi dengan cepat ke halaman konfigurasi ekstensi. |
⚙️ Konfigurasi Shell (Penting!)
Fitur ini memungkinkan Anda memilih shell mana yang akan digunakan extension untuk mengeksekusi program Anda. Nilai default-nya adalah PowerShell.
Cara Mengubah Shell Default
- Akses Pengaturan: Buka Command Palette (Ctrl+Shift+P atau F1).
- Ketik dan pilih command:
Open C/C++ Runner Settings
. - Di bilah pencarian pengaturan, cari:
C/C++ Runner: Execution Shell
. - Pilih salah satu dari opsi berikut:
PowerShell
(Disarankan): Menggunakanpowershell.exe
.CMD
: Menggunakancmd.exe
.
Alur Kerja
Ketika Anda menjalankan extension:
- Buka file C atau C++ Anda.
- Tekan F5 (atau klik ikon Run di bilah judul editor).
- Extension mengkompilasi file tersebut.
- Jendela shell eksternal (PS atau CMD) terbuka, menjalankan program Anda, dan tetap terbuka (pause) hingga Anda menekan tombol apa pun.